Some of these boys have been in the job way too long and one only needs to observe how friendly they are with some Jocks around the traps...it's human nature ...but they need to be better than that They're very sensitive to criticism still...and that's good to see After Bruce Sherwin strongly questioned the ride of GIOVANNI CAVALETTO on Weigh In..."that run had Trial written all over it" Oatham dragged Collett in at HQ on Tuesday for a slap Racing Tauranga - Saturday 3 November 2018 Race 6 - Chesters Plumbing & Bathroom 1300 GIOVANNI CANALETTO (S Collett) - Rider S Collett was questioned regarding her riding tactics advising that her instructions had been to ride the gelding, which was having its first start for some 2 1⁄2 years, quietly in the early stages with the intention to ride for luck if necessary. S Collett further advised that after beginning fairly the gelding had been hampered shortly after the start and had raced a little ungenerously in the early to middle stages making contact with the running rail near the 700 metres and laying in early in the final straight but once fully balanced had worked home well. Whilst noting the explanation of S Collett she was advised that her lack of vigour between the 400 metres and 250 metres had been of concern when in the Stewards view she should have made more effort to track YOUR WAY into the race.
